No civil service pay cuts: Prasad

Minister for Finance, Professor Biman Prasad, says that there will not be any pay cuts for civil servants.

In a press conference, Prof Prasad said these were rumours and misinformation spread by those in the previous government during the campaign period.

“Let not beat the drum on behalf of the previous government, and let me assure civil servants that this is not on the agenda of the Political Parties, particularly the Coalition Government.”

However, Prof Prasad said that the Prime Minister, Sitiveni Rabuka, is expected to make an announcement on pay reductions for the Prime Minister and the Ministers in the coming days.

He said this is expected to happen.

“We are already on a 20 per cent pay reduction from the last parliament term, that’s still there. The Prime Minister will make that announcement on that front soon.”
